Subject: Turnstile counter ownership change

Effective Monday, responsibility for the GateTally counter service at Drossmere Arena moves off my plate. All release approvals, firmware rollouts to turnstile units, and discrepancy reports route to the new owner. Open items: the bank-D undercount fix is staged but unshipped; hold it until the next maintenance window. I've transferred the runbook and dashboard access already. For sign-off on the pending release, contact the person named below.

named custodian: Brivan Eliath Quenox Frador

## Evacuation Chair Store — Ground Floor

The evacuation-chair store at Harlow Point sits behind reception, beside the west stairwell. Reception staff must check the chair monthly and log the inspection in the Kestrel binder. The store door remains locked at all times; do not prop it open, even during drills. If the chair is deployed, notify the Bramleigh Facilities team immediately. The door accepts the following pass code.

turnstile pass: bdg-JVSWH-52711

Prepared for the incoming director. Chaired by Selma Vorn; all product and finance leads present.

The committee reviewed pricing for the Ardelle instrument line in detail. Agreed: list prices rise 6% effective next quarter; volume discounts capped at 12%; the entry-tier Ardelle Mini holds at current pricing to protect adoption. Finance will model margin impact by region before final sign-off. Objections were noted from channel sales and recorded. The strategic rationale is set out directly below.

board note of bawep-tajef: Queniusek Systems plans to raise the Quenvan list price by 53.1 percent in March. The pricing group signed off on a budget of $176.4 million for Project Drueth. The renewal with Casionix Partners closes at $142.5 million a year, 8.3 percent below the last contract. Project Fraax slips by six weeks because of the tooling delay.